Former Friends star David Schwimmer is to join the cast of Julia Davis and Nick Muhammad‘s new six-part Channel 4 sitcom, Morning Has Broken.

The half-hour episodes will see Davis take on the role of Gail Sinclair, the ‘Queen of Daytime,’ and star of ‘Good Morning… with Gail Sinclair.’

After eight glorious years of high ratings and winning awards, things begin to go wrong for Sinclair when the programme begins to lose viewers and tensions break out within the production team.

Schwimmer will play an American producer brought in to try and save the floundering show. Nick Mohammed will play one of Gail’s fellow breakfast anchors.

Co-writer and star of Morning Has Broken, Julia Davis said she is “looking forward to experimenting with friends whose work I love.”

David Schwimmer added, “I’ve been a massive fan of Julia’s for years, and I’m thrilled to be able to finally work with her and Nick on this fantastic comedy.”

Rachel Springett, Commissioning Editor for Comedy at Channel 4 said, “Julia is undoubtedly one of our most talented comedic writers and actresses and it’s a testament to the quality of her writing that she can attract such a big star. We are thrilled to have David Schwimmer star alongside Julia in this exciting new series for the channel.”

Morning Has Broken is made by Brown Eyed Boy in association with Sony Pictures Television, the series will be produced by Gary Reich for transmission on Channel 4 in 2016.
